A time-twisting platformer about precision, planning, and seeing your past actions come to life.
Delayed is a 2D platformer I worked on during the summer of 2025 as a level designer and pixel artist. The project received a grant from Sammes Stiftelse in Skellefteå, which allowed us to spend the summer developing the prototype.
In Delayed, you play as a small robot whose inputs are recorded as you move. When you think you have finished the level, you press Enter and watch the robot replay your recorded actions.
The idea came from a classmate who wanted a game designer involved and knew that I also worked with pixel art, so that became my role. I was part of shaping the concept and tone of the game, refining the movement feel, and designing several of the main gameplay features.
I created the robot character and animations in Aseprite, built several levels in Unity, and designed the main collectible. I also created all the Steam page artwork, though these may change as the project develops.
My work on Delayed is currently on hold while I focus on my studies, but I am proud of what we have built and excited to see where it goes next. The game is already listed on Steam, and we have been active in the local game community in Skellefteå, showing it to the public and even being featured in the local newspaper.
